The Khajuraho Festival of Dances draws the best classical dancers in the country who perform against the spectacular backdrop of the floodlit temples every year in February/March.

The past and the present silhouetted against the glow of a setting sun becomes an exquisite backdrop for the performers.

In a setting where the earthly and the divine create perfect harmony - an event that celebrates the pure magic of the rich classical dance traditions of India. As dusk falls, the temples are lit up in a soft, dream-like ethereal stage.

The finest exponents of different classical Indian styles are represented- Kathak, Bharatnatyam, Kuchipudi, Odissi, Manipuri, and many more.
